Sony on Tuesday agreed to buy Bertelsmann out of Sony BMG, giving the Japanese electronics group control of the world’s second largest record company for an initial $600m while allowing the German media group to claim proceeds of $1.5bn.
The move ends a joint venture formed in 2004 by merging Sony Music and Bertelsmann’s BMG as a response to the shock of the internet and digitisation that spread the power of recording and distributing music from the old hands to all comers.
